2023年最佳游戏开发工具推荐,提升效率的利器可以玩pg的电子软件
2023年最佳游戏开发工具推荐,提升效率的利器可以玩pg的电子软件,
本文目录导读:
随着游戏行业的发展,游戏开发工具的重要性日益凸显,无论是3D建模、动画制作、脚本编写,还是游戏测试与发布,都离不开高效可靠的工具,本文将为您推荐一些在2023年非常值得尝试的游戏开发工具,帮助您提升开发效率,降低成本,推动游戏项目向前发展。
3D建模与动画是游戏开发中不可或缺的环节,用于构建游戏的虚拟世界,无论是角色、场景,还是物品,都需要精确的建模和动画制作,以下是几种在2023年非常流行的3D建模与动画工具。
Blender
Blender是一款开源的3D建模与动画软件,以其强大的功能和灵活的编辑器界面而闻名,它支持多种建模方式,包括网格建模、曲线建模和点云建模,适合初学者和专业开发人员使用。
优点:
- 开源免费,适合个人和团队使用
- 支持多种建模方式,适应不同需求
- 具备强大的动画引擎,支持2D和3D动画制作
- 用户社区活跃,资源丰富
- 在教育环境中广受欢迎,提供丰富的教程和学习资源
缺点:
- 学习曲线较陡峭,新手需要时间适应
- 高级功能需要付费订阅
Maya
Maya是Autodesk公司开发的高端3D建模与动画软件,广泛应用于影视、游戏、虚拟现实等领域,它提供了丰富的工具和效果,能够满足专业开发人员的需求。
优点:
- 高度专业化的工具,支持复杂场景的建模和动画
- 提供高质量的渲染效果,适合影视制作
- 支持多平台部署,兼容Windows、Mac和Linux
- 有强大的动画绑定和约束功能
- 在影视和游戏行业中享有极高的声誉
缺点:
- 成本较高,不适合个人开发者
- 学习曲线较陡峭,需要较长时间学习
Softimage
Softimage是一款专注于影视和游戏开发的3D建模与动画软件,它提供了直观的界面和强大的功能,能够帮助开发者高效完成项目。
优点:
- 高度直观的界面,操作简便
- 提供强大的动画绑定和约束功能
- 支持多线程渲染,提升效率
- 有丰富的插件和效果
- 在游戏开发中表现出色,提供专业的动画解决方案
缺点:
- 成本较高,不适合个人开发者
- 学习曲线较陡峭
脚本编写与自动化:提升开发效率的关键
脚本编写是游戏开发中非常重要的环节,用于实现游戏的逻辑和自动化操作,以下是几种在2023年非常受欢迎的脚本编写工具。
Unity
Unity是一款跨平台的游戏引擎,支持C#脚本编写,它提供了丰富的工具和功能,能够帮助开发者高效完成项目。
优点:
- 支持多种平台,包括移动、PC和主机
- 提供强大的脚本编辑器和调试工具
- 具备强大的插件系统,扩展功能
- 有庞大的社区和丰富的资源
- 在游戏开发中表现出色,提供专业的脚本解决方案
缺点:
- 脚本性能可能较低,需要优化
- 学习曲线较陡峭,需要较长时间学习
Unreal Engine
Unreal Engine是另一款跨平台的游戏引擎,支持C++和Python脚本编写,它提供了高度可定制的环境,能够帮助开发者实现复杂的逻辑。
优点:
- 支持多种平台,包括移动、PC和主机
- 提供强大的脚本编辑器和调试工具
- 具备强大的插件系统,扩展功能
- 有庞大的社区和丰富的资源
- 在游戏开发中表现出色,提供专业的脚本解决方案
缺点:
- 脚本性能可能较低,需要优化
- 学习曲线较陡峭,需要较长时间学习
Godot Engine
Godot Engine是一款开源的游戏引擎,支持多种脚本语言,包括C#和Python,它提供了高度可定制的环境,能够帮助开发者实现复杂的逻辑。
优点:
- 开源免费,适合个人和团队使用
- 支持多种脚本语言,灵活选择
- 提供强大的工具和效果
- 用户社区活跃,资源丰富
- 在游戏开发中表现出色,提供专业的脚本解决方案
缺点:
- 学习曲线较陡峭,需要较长时间学习
- 高级功能需要付费订阅
游戏测试与发布:确保产品质量的关键
游戏测试与发布是游戏开发中非常重要的环节,用于确保游戏的质量和稳定性,以下是几种在2023年非常受欢迎的游戏测试与发布工具。
Postman
Postman是一款在线的调试和测试工具,支持多种游戏引擎,包括Unity和Unreal Engine,它提供了强大的调试功能,能够帮助开发者快速定位问题。
优点:
- 在线使用,无需下载
- 提供强大的调试功能
- 支持多种游戏引擎
- 用户社区活跃,资源丰富
- 在自动化测试中表现出色,提供高效的测试解决方案
缺点:
- 功能较为基础,无法自定义
- 学习曲线较陡峭
Asset Store
Asset Store是Unity社区提供的一个在线商店,提供各种游戏资产,包括脚本、模型、动画等,它帮助开发者节省时间和成本。
优点:
- 提供各种游戏资产,节省开发时间
- 用户社区活跃,资源丰富
- 支持多种游戏引擎
- 在资源获取中表现出色,提供高质量的开发材料
缺点:
- 资源可能需要付费订阅
- 部分资源质量参差不齐
Unity Editor
Unity Editor是Unity官方提供的在线编辑器,支持多种脚本语言,包括C#和Python,它提供了强大的工具和功能,能够帮助开发者高效完成项目。
优点:
- 在线使用,无需下载
- 提供强大的工具和效果
- 支持多种脚本语言
- 用户社区活跃,资源丰富
- 在开发环境中表现出色,提供高效的编辑解决方案
缺点:
- 功能较为基础,无法自定义
- 学习曲线较陡峭
2023年,游戏开发工具越来越多样化和专业化,无论是3D建模与动画,脚本编写,还是游戏测试与发布,都提供了一些非常值得尝试的工具,选择适合自己的工具,能够显著提升开发效率,降低成本,推动游戏项目向前发展。
希望本文的推荐能够帮助您找到适合自己的游戏开发工具,开启您的游戏开发之旅!
发表评论